NGC 165 - galaxy in the constellation Ceti Type: SBbc - spiral galaxy with bar The angular dimensions: 1.60'x1.3' magnitude: V=13.1m; B=13.9m The surface brightness: 13.7 mag/arcmin2 Coordinates for epoch J2000: Ra= 0h36m28.9s; Dec= -10°6'23" redshift (z): 0.019617 The distance from the Sun to NGC 165: based on the amount of redshift (z) - 82.9 Mpc; Other names of the object NGC 165 : PGC 2182, MCG -2-2-69, IRAS 00339-1022
